Ingredients You’ll Need
To make this delightful dessert, you’ll need the following ingredients:
- 2 cups fruit puree or juice
- 1 Tbsp. gelatin
- Honey (optional, to taste)

When it comes to fruit, don’t stress about fancy ingredients. Use whatever you have in your fridge; you could blend berries, peaches, or even apples. Just remember, the riper the fruit, the sweeter your dessert will turn out. And if you’re using juice, aim for 100% juice without added sugars for a healthier option.
Step-by-Step Directions
Now, let’s get into the nitty-gritty of making this gel dessert.
Prepare your fruit puree or juice by blending fresh fruits until smooth. If you go with berries, you might want to strain out the seeds for a smoother texture.
In a small bowl, sprinkle the gelatin over 1/4 cup of cold water and let it bloom for about 5 minutes. This step helps the gelatin dissolve evenly.
In a saucepan, heat the fruit puree or juice until warm but not boiling. You just want it hot enough to dissolve the gelatin efficiently.
Remove from heat and stir in the bloomed gelatin until completely dissolved. Keep stirring to ensure no clumps are left behind.
Sweeten with honey to taste, if desired. Remember, start small—you can always add more, but it’s tough to take away sweetness.
Pour the mixture into molds or cups and refrigerate until set, usually about 4 hours. Look for a firm but springy texture when it’s ready.

Storage & Reheat (No Soggy Leftovers)
Storing leftovers is simple, and thankfully, they stay tasty without any fuss. Just cover your molds or transfer the gel into an airtight container before placing it in the fridge. It should last for up to a week, though good luck keeping it around that long!
If you want to save some for later on a hot day, you can even freeze the gelatin. Just remember, it’s best enjoyed fresh and chilled, so be aware that the texture may change a bit after thawing.

Variations That Work
Feel free to get creative with this Healthier Gelatin Dessert. You can switch out the type of fruit you use for variety. Here are a few ideas to get you started:
- For tropical vibes, use pineapple or mango puree.
- A splash of coconut milk mixed in can add a delicious creaminess.
- Add some zest from lemons or limes for a refreshing citrus kick.
Also, you can try adding some chopped fruit into the mixture for added texture. There are endless ways to tweak your dessert while keeping it healthy.
FAQs About Healthier Gelatin Dessert
Can I make this ahead?
Yep. It actually tastes even better the next day when the flavors settle.
How long does it last?
In the fridge, it typically lasts about a week. If you’ve got leftovers, that’s perfect for surprise snack attacks.
What brands of gelatin work best?
Any unflavored gelatin works well. I’ve had great results with brands like Knox or similar.
Can I use flavored gelatin?
For this healthier version, it’s best to stick with unflavored. You can control the sweetness and flavor more effectively.
Is it possible to make this vegan?
Yes, there are plant-based gelatins available. Just check the package, and you can easily adapt this recipe.
